Enabling/disabling device on hardware profile
Just upgraded my Laptop from XP to Vista and lost some important
functionality: In XP I could enable/disable devices based on the hardware
profile.
I used this for the WiFi adaptor. When the machine is docked the WiFi
adaptor was disabled and it used the docking ports 1GB network adaptor. On
un-docking it, it was enabled, so that I could roam the office and still have
connectivity (albeit at a WiFi speed).
In Vista, I either have to have the WiFi ALWAYS enabled, or NEVER enabled.
ALWAYS causes problems with two connections simultaneously - Vista gets
itself confused and does not necessarily use the fast connection (ie 1GB).
NEVER is no good - I cannot access the network.
So I now, have to manually enable/disable the device when I undock/dock the
laptop...
